#d4a49d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d4a49d is composed of 83.1% red, 64.3% green and 61.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 22.6% magenta, 25.9%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 7.6 degrees, a saturation of 39% and a lightness of 72.4%. #d4a49d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a9493b.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

#d4a49d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d4a49d has RGB values of R:212, G:164, B:157 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.23, Y:0.26,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13935773.
